Looking through the film references section of the GR wiki, it looks like the only references to an actual film is, of course, King Kong. And there's a reference to the son ( not capitalized) of Frankenstein. He mentions Cecil B. Demille, the Marx Brothers, and offhandedly, Bela Lugosi. I guess clips of various German expressionist movies from the 20s would best capture the book.
